Singapore High Court declares cryptocurrency as property, rules in favor of ByBit in trust case
[ad_1] A Singaporean High Court has ruled that cryptocurrency is a property capable of being held in trust, according to a July 25 ruling. Craig Wright unable to provide sufficient evidence of funds in latest Satoshi court case
[ad_1] In the latest legal chapter of the ongoing Satoshi Nakamoto identity saga, self-proclaimed Bitcoin creator Craig Wright has been unable to satisfy a U.K. High Court judge that he has sufficient funds to cover potential legal costs in his lawsuit against cryptocurrency exchanges Coinbase and Kraken. Hong Kong based stablecoin FDUSD goes live on Binance with monthly audits
[ad_1] Hong Kong-based First Digital Group announced on July 26 that its stablecoin, First Digital USD (FDUSD), has been listed on Binance, the world’s largest cryptocurrency exchange by volume. US Accountability Office says regulators need ‘coordination mechanism’ to tackle crypto oversight
[ad_1] The U.S. Accountability Office (GAO) believes significant regulatory gaps in the crypto industry — specifically related to spot cryptocurrency markets and stablecoins — need to be addressed via a government-wide approach before they become a risk to financial stability. Additional $37M discovered in web3 casino payment provider hack
[ad_1] Alphapo, a cryptocurrency payment service provider, reportedly suffered a significant security breach within its hot wallet, resulting in a loss of over $60 million, with some reports suggesting total losses could amount to around $100 million, according to De.Fi, the web3 antivirus company.
